#6846f4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6846f4 is composed of 40.8% red, 27.5% green and 95.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 57.4% cyan, 71.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 251.7 degrees, a saturation of 88.8% and a lightness of 61.6%. #6846f4 color hex could be obtained by blending #d08cff with #0000e9. Closest websafe color is: #6633ff.

#6846f4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6846f4 has RGB values of R:104, G:70, B:244 and CMYK values of C:0.57, M:0.71, Y:0,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 6833908.
